True Corporation Public Company Limited, commonly known as True, is a leading telecommunications and digital services provider headquartered in Thailand. Established in 1990, True has significantly shaped the industry by offering a diverse range of services, including mobile, broadband, and digital television, primarily across Thailand and neighbouring regions. True stands out for its innovative approach to integrated telecommunications, combining high-speed internet with extensive mobile coverage and advanced digital solutions. The company has achieved notable milestones, such as being a pioneer in 5G technology deployment in Thailand, enhancing its market position as a frontrunner in the digital landscape. With a commitment to quality and customer satisfaction, True continues to drive growth and transformation in the telecommunications sector.

True's reported carbon emissions

In 2024, True Corporation Public Company Limited reported total greenhouse gas emissions of approximately 9,721,320 kg CO2e for Scope 1, 661,048,990 kg CO2e for Scope 2 (market-based), and 227,916,050 kg CO2e for Scope 3 emissions. This reflects a significant reduction from 2023, where emissions were about 15,777,790 kg CO2e for Scope 1, 702,553,860 kg CO2e for Scope 2 (market-based), and 343,832,000 kg CO2e for Scope 3. True has set ambitious climate commitments, aiming to achieve net-zero greenhouse gas emissions across all scopes by 2050. Near-term targets include a 42% reduction in absolute Scope 1 and 2 emissions by 2030, based on a 2020 baseline, and a 25% reduction in absolute Scope 3 emissions within the same timeframe. Additionally, True aims to reduce emissions intensity by 10% per service revenue by 2020 compared to 2016 levels. The company has made strides in its sustainability efforts, including a 15% reduction in Scope 1 emissions from 2017 to 2018 and a 24.54% reduction in Scope 2 emissions during the same period. True's commitments align with the Science-Based Targets Initiative (SBTi), ensuring that their targets are consistent with the global goal of limiting temperature rise to 1.5°C. Overall, True Corporation is actively working towards a sustainable future, with a clear roadmap for reducing its carbon footprint and contributing to global climate goals.
